American Coalition for Ethanol Pleased with President Obama's Plan for Jobs

Fri, 09 Sep 2011 11:16:30 CDT

American Coalition for Ethanol Pleased with President Obama's Plan for Jobs President Barack Obama is proposing a new jobs package bill termed the American Jobs Act before Congress. The proposed legislation is aimed at improving the country's infrastructure by primarily focusing on funding for new jobs programs and construction projects. The bill will now be debated in Congress.


Brian Jennings, Executive Vice President of the American Coalition for Ethanol, released the following statement.


"The President is precisely right that the best way to create U.S. jobs is for us to produce things at home that the world wants and needs. We are encouraged that the President is suggesting some changes regarding taxes for companies including, Big Oil. The ethanol industry is willing to work with both the White House and Congress on sensible measures such as our effort to reform the existing Volumetric Ethanol Excise Tax Credit (VEETC)."


"Ethanol is perhaps the most successful example of how American farmers and entrepreneurs have created small businesses and jobs to process crops and biomass into fuel and feed, not just for America but for the entire world. ACE wants to build on that current success by improving market access to ethanol, which includes more blender pumps, more Flex-Fuel Vehicles and the commercialization of cellulosic ethanol. We intend to be a strong advocate for the biofuels industry as we work with the White House and Congress on the proposed jobs package."
